About this chess game
This chess game between Afruzbek Sobirov (2252) and Alimzhan Amirkul (2357) was played at Kayumov Memorial 2025 in 2025 and finished 0–1. The opening was the Sicilian Defense: Nyezhmetdinov-Rossolimo Attack, Fianchetto Variation (B31).
